i am trying to decide what type of mounts to use for my s16 conversion and canvass peoples views/opinions on the best options

 

i dont really want to use a Group N bottom mount as it seems to be way too hard for an everyday car with its bone shaking and rattles etc

but i am concerned that perhaps the standard mounts may be to soft, i really dont know.

 

my current set up on my 1.9s is standard mounts with the top mounts front buffer pad using spacer to limit movement as much as possible.

this was/is successful to a good degree but did not stop my magnex manifold catching the the bulkhead on acceleration, i though i would have to fit a group N bottom mount jobbie but as a last resort i put another standard mount in rotated 90 degrees so the rubber that contacts the metal outer ring from the centre of the bush were vertical instead of horizontal (hope you get what i mean)

 

this did the trick, luckily.

 

will the same set up work for a 16v engine, if not i have read posts in the past that there are harder bushes available from peugeot/citroen as standard on other vehicles, harder than the 205gti but not as hard as Group N.

i seem to remember xantia activa, bx gti, td 405 being mentioned amongst others on here over the years but alot of these posts are now a good 3-4 years old and i am just wondering if this is still the case or if someone hascome up with a better solution since they were written

Xanthia Petrol Turbo engine mount fits the pug

 

Part No 180921

 

10.18 Pounds when I priced them last. They're harder than std but softer than GpN. This is the lower mount BTW!
